首页 > 综合 > 甄选问答 >

multiple函数

2026-01-16 23:35:20
最佳答案

multiple函数】在编程和数学中,"multiple函数" 通常指的是用于判断一个数是否是另一个数的倍数的函数。虽然在某些编程语言中并没有直接名为 `multiple` 的内置函数,但可以通过自定义函数实现类似功能。该函数在数据处理、算法设计以及数学计算中具有广泛的应用。

一、multiple函数的功能

`multiple` 函数的主要作用是判断一个数是否为另一个数的倍数。例如,判断 12 是否是 3 的倍数,或者 20 是否是 5 的倍数。其核心逻辑是通过取模运算(%)来判断余数是否为零。

二、multiple函数的实现方式

以下是一个常见的 `multiple` 函数的伪代码实现:

```python

def multiple(a, b):

if b == 0:

return False 避免除以零错误

return a % b == 0

```

该函数接受两个参数 `a` 和 `b`,返回布尔值,表示 `a` 是否是 `b` 的倍数。

三、使用场景

场景 描述
数学计算 判断数值之间的倍数关系
数据筛选 在数据集中筛选出特定倍数的数据
算法优化 在循环或条件判断中提高效率
游戏开发 控制事件触发频率(如每隔一定步数执行一次)

四、示例演示

a b multiple(a, b) 说明
12 3 True 12 ÷ 3 = 4,无余数
20 5 True 20 ÷ 5 = 4,无余数
7 3 False 7 ÷ 3 = 2 余 1
15 0 False 除数不能为零
0 5 True 0 是任何非零数的倍数

五、注意事项

- 避免除以零:在实际应用中应加入对 `b=0` 的判断,防止程序崩溃。

- 数据类型兼容性:确保输入参数为整数,否则可能导致错误结果。

- 性能优化:在大规模数据处理中,应尽量减少重复调用 `multiple` 函数。

六、总结

`multiple` 函数虽不常见于标准库中,但在实际编程中非常实用。它能有效帮助开发者判断数值之间的倍数关系,适用于多种应用场景。通过合理设计与使用,可以提升代码的可读性和运行效率。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。